Abstract

The scope of this project was to design a system for dosing Citric Acid and sodium hydroxide (NaOH) into GE Healthcare’s 4200 L bio-processing tank, as part of an automated cleaning cycle. The designed system is intended to:

  • Minimize employee exposure to chemicals
  • Dose the necessary amount of chemicals in 3 minutes or less
  • Dose the necessary chemicals within a 0.5% tolerance
  • Neutralize the cleaning solution to a pH level between 6 and 9
  • Have a design-life of at least 10 years
